Philippe Starck
Philippe Starck is a renowned French designer and architect, celebrated for his eclectic and innovative approach to design. His work spans a wide array of industries, including furniture, product design, and architecture, making him a pivotal figure in contemporary design.
Born on Jan 18, 1949 (77 years old)
